An Advanced Certificate in Climate Policy Reporting equips journalists, communicators, and analysts with the skills to effectively report on the complex and evolving landscape of climate change policy. The program focuses on delivering in-depth knowledge of international agreements, national legislation, and corporate sustainability strategies.
Learning outcomes include mastering the nuanced language of climate policy, developing critical analysis skills for evaluating policy effectiveness, and crafting compelling narratives that inform and engage diverse audiences. Students will learn to utilize data visualization techniques to present complex climate information clearly and concisely, essential for impactful climate journalism.
